There are two bands with the name Crossfade. 1. An American post-grunge band 2. A Swedish pop rock band 1. Crossfade is an American rock band from Columbia, South Carolina. Their current members are Ed Sloan on lead vocals and guitar, Les Hall on Lead guitar, keyboard, and backing vocals, and Mitch James on backing vocals and bass. Since their formation in 1999 Crossfade has released two studio albums - their platinum selling self-titled debut album in 2004, and Falling Away in 2006. Crossfader is currently a shared name between two projects - one Industrial Hardcore, the other Rock/Pop. 1. Crossfader was a five-man hardcore industrial group formed in Cleveland, Ohio in 2001. The group was made up of many members of Mushroomhead; Jason Popson on Vocals, Steve Felton on drums and Rick Thomas on turntables along with Craig Martini on Bass and Dizmo on guitar. The group made five epic songs together on their first Demo and later decided to call it quits. They haven't regrouped to continue making music since. 2. Crossfader were born of ingenuity.
